> > +/**
> > + * get_ipv6_ext_hdrs() - Parses packet and sets IPv6 extension header flags.
> > + *
> > + * @skb: buffer where extension header data starts in packet
> > + * @nh: ipv6 header
> > + * @ext_hdrs: flags are stored here
> > + *
> > + * OFPIEH12_UNREP is set if more than one of a given IPv6 extension header
> > + * is unexpectedly encountered. (Two destination options headers may be
> > + * expected and would not cause this bit to be set.)
> > + *
> > + * OFPIEH12_UNSEQ is set if IPv6 extension headers were not in the order
> > + * preferred (but not required) by RFC 2460:
> > + *
> > + * When more than one extension header is used in the same packet, it is
> > + * recommended that those headers appear in the following order:
> > + *      IPv6 header
> > + *      Hop-by-Hop Options header
> > + *      Destination Options header
> > + *      Routing header
> > + *      Fragment header
> > + *      Authentication header
> > + *      Encapsulating Security Payload header
> > + *      Destination Options header
> > + *      upper-layer header
> > + */
